Why it scores where it does

Mindset for Success ranks #6094 on The B2B Podcast Index with a substance score of 28.0 out of 100, scored across 1 recent episode. It scores highest on insight density and specificity & evidence. The entire episode rehashes three generic job-interview tips from a single unnamed CNBC article, offering no novel analysis beyond the source material. There is almost no actionable depth for a B2B operator; the content is filler with brief paraphrases of surface-level advice.
